Cost of Replacement Car Keys
It's a big problem to lose your car keys. The cost of replacing them is also a major expense.
The most cost-effective and easiest method to replace your car keys is to contact an auto locksmith. You can also request your key cloned at an expert dealer, however they'll charge you more.

Technology Type
While keys to cars and remote controls may appear to be ordinary metal objects, they're actually electronic devices in miniature form. Therefore they have more to them than meets the eye -- and this is why they're expensive to replace.
The type of key you're using will also impact the amount it will cost you to purchase a replacement. Key fobs with standard locks are inexpensive to duplicate, however they're not as robust as the newer models that have an additional layer of security. They have a unique key head that has a small chip in it that communicates with the car's computer to verify that the key is legitimate. A duplicate key won't work without the chip even in the event that it has the same grooves and ridges as the original. These keys are more expensive than conventional ones due to the fact that they require two steps in cutting the laser and programming the key to your vehicle.
In some cases, a locksmith will need to take apart the transponder chip in order to program it correctly. This is a dangerous job that should be performed only by a locksmith with special training. The process can be very lengthy and costly if they have to replace other parts including the housing that holds the chip.
You'll need to take your car to a dealer to get an ignition key programmed. You'll need proof of ownership such as the registration papers or title documents. You'll also have to wait for the dealer to make an order and connect a new key with your current key.

Where You Live
The place you live will affect how much a locksmith or car dealer charges for key replacement. The prices are higher in big cities than in small towns or rural areas. This is because the service provider must travel farther to get to you, which results in more expensive costs.
Another factor that can impact the cost of replacing car keys is the time and location you lose your keys. The cost of a replacement key will be higher if lose them on a holiday, or during the night. There may be a charge for the inconvenience of waiting for a technician.
The type of key that you have could also affect the price. Some cars come with only basic mechanical keys or standard keys whereas others have transponder chips, keys fobs or smart keys. Keys which are more technologically advanced will cost more to replace.
Some of these high-tech keys need to be programmed by an auto locksmith or dealership. It could take up to about an hour or more, and is one of the main reasons why a high-tech lock will cost more than a standard one.
People who own older cars with standard keys that don't include transponder chips, will usually pay less for an entirely new key. Standard key cutting usually requires a look at the cuts on the ignition of the car or using the VIN number to determine the correct key for the car.
A lot of keys require that they are connected to the computer in the vehicle in order to unlock the doors and start the engines. It is possible to contact the dealership that sold you your car if you're in a position to locate your keys. However it isn't always feasible.
Based on your insurance policy, it may be possible to file a claim with them to cover the cost of an alternative key or fob. Assistance companies for roadside emergencies like AAA may also be able to help but they'll only provide a basic key and not the latest technology.

Traditional keys made of metal that don't have a transponder chip in them are much cheaper to replace. They can be duplicated at a hardware store for less than $10. However, a smarter key has to be linked with your vehicle and programmed by an auto locksmith or dealership. This could cost as much as $200 or more.
Key fobs are now offered in many vehicles that connect to the vehicle's computer using radio frequency identification. These keys are more difficult to copy, and they are designed to guard against theft. The cost to replace keys of this kind can be as high as $500 or more.
